Industry Applications & Specialized Solutions
Our capacitor banks are engineered for demanding power systems where reliable reactive compensation is critical and execution risk must be minimized. Because standard catalog equipment frequently falls short in complex environments, we build solutions specifically tailored for a wide spectrum of demanding applications. For example:
- Heavy Industrial, Mining & Manufacturing: Managing the fluctuating reactive power demands of large motors and cyclic loads to optimize capacity and avoid utility power factor penalties.
- Oil, Gas & Petrochemical: Supporting continuous production and stable voltage profiles for pipeline pumping stations, refineries, and offshore facilities by delivering reliable reactive power on weak or remote grids.
- Renewable Energy & Distributed Generation: Providing essential reactive compensation to meet grid interconnection requirements for wind, solar, and battery storage collector systems.
- Mission-Critical Infrastructure & Data Centers: Supporting sensitive computing and data processing infrastructure with reactive compensation and transient-free switching technologies designed to maintain stable system voltage and minimize power quality disturbances.
- Utility & Municipal Distribution: Enhancing grid efficiency and voltage regulation in increasingly constrained distribution networks while supporting the modernization of legacy reactive compensation equipment with fully integrated, system-fit solutions.
- Specialized & Complex Grids: Meeting the demands of specialized and complex power systems through system-fit engineering led by subject matter experts who understand the electrical, physical, and operational constraints of each application.

Metal-Enclosed Integration (Scope)
VarStec capacitor banks are fully compartmentalized, metal-enclosed, and ready-to-install solutions that house all switching, all protection, and all control functions within a single integrated package. This approach reduces the safety risks, delays, and variables associated with traditional open-air or field-assembled banks. Each system is engineered to seamlessly integrate with your existing infrastructure, ensuring reactive compensation and safe, reliable operation from day one.
Adaptive & Filter-Ready Designs
Our capacitor banks feature adaptive, scalable configurations, including filter-ready designs that can be seamlessly upgraded to harmonic filter banks if plant expansions or changing grid conditions introduce new resonance risks.
Advanced Switching Integration
Designed to incorporate advanced transient-free switching technologies to eliminate the damaging inrush currents and voltage transients that can plague sensitive site infrastructure.
